Weng Sends Imejjane Into the Blender

Level 12 : 2,000/4,000, 4,000 ante

From early position Badr Imejjane raised to 9,000, Alain Bauer called in the small blind. Bin Weng three-bet to 46,000 from the big blind. Imejjane then four-bet to 115,000, Bauer tanked a bit before he folded and Weng came along for the ride.

The flop came {a-Hearts}{4-Hearts}{10-Diamonds}. Both players checked. The turn was the {9-Diamonds}, Weng led for 114,000 which sent Imejjane into the blender. He looked uncomfortable and stewed over the decision while shaking his head. After a couple a minutes he folded and sent Weng the big pot.
